Kentucky women's basketball lost to Texas in the NCAA Tournament Sweet 16, but here's an early look at Kenny Brooks' 2026-27 Kentucky Wildcats roster.

Year 2 of the Kenny Brooks era with Kentucky basketball met its end Saturday. UK, the No. 5 seed in Region 3 of the NCAA Tournament , couldn't topple top-seeded Texas in the Sweet 16, as the Longhorns earned a 76-54 victory at Dickies Arena .

The Wildcats now turn their attention to the 2026-27 campaign. Here's a look at Kentucky 's upcoming offseason, as well as what its 2026-27 roster might look like: Which Kentucky women's basketball players could leave? UK has five players who have exhausted their college eligibility: Josie Gilvin , Amelia Hassett , Teonni Key , Tonie Morgan and Jordan Obi .

Hassett, Key and Morgan constituted three-fifths of the starting lineup. Obi was a primary member of the rotation (appearing in all 36 games, with 25 starts). Gilvin, who transferred in from Western Kentucky, played in 24 games as a reserve but averaged less than 7 minutes per outing.

The other four were major contributors. Morgan, the team's PG1, set a single-season program record for assists (286), which doubled as the third-most by any SEC player in one campaign. Her 8 assists per game entering Saturday ranked second nationally to Northwestern's Caroline Lau at 8.
